    Job Summary

    We are seeking a skilled and experienced Liebherr Crane Mechanic to join our Audubon team. The ideal candidate will have a minimum of five (5) years of mechanical experience, with a strong preference for hands-on experience working with Liebherr LR and LTM cranes. This role is responsible for diagnosing, repairing, maintaining, and inspecting cranes to ensure safe and efficient operation.

    Key Responsibilities

    • Perform routine maintenance, inspections, and repairs on Liebherr cranes and related equipment
    • Diagnose mechanical, hydraulic, and electrical issues and implement effective solutions
    • Conduct preventative maintenance to minimize downtime and extend equipment life
    • Troubleshoot and repair hydraulic systems, engines, transmissions, and electrical components
    • Read and interpret technical manuals, schematics, and diagnostic tools
    • Perform safety checks and ensure compliance with company and regulatory standards
    • Maintain accurate service records and documentation of repairs
    • Help coordinate with operations and supervisors to schedule maintenance and repairs
    • Respond to field service calls as needed

    Qualifications

    • Minimum of 5 years of mechanic experience (heavy equipment or crane experience required)
    • Direct experience working with Liebherr LR and LTM cranes preferred
    • Strong knowledge of hydraulic, electrical, and mechanical systems
    • Ability to use diagnostic tools and software
    • Proficient in reading technical manuals and schematics
    • Valid driver's license with good MVR
    • Ability to work independently and in a team environment

    Skills & Competencies

    •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ills
    • Attention to detail and commitment to safety
    • Good communication and organizational skills
    • Ability to work under pressure and meet deadlines
    • Must be able to work overtime and travel when required

    Physical Requirements

    •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s
    • Capable of working in outdoor environments and varying weather conditions
    • Comfortable working at heights and in confined spaces

    Preferred Certifications

    • OEM training or certification on Liebherr equipment
    • NCCCO or other crane-related certifications (a plus)

    Work Environment

    • Field-based work and very little shop work
    • Will require travel to job sites
    • Exposure to noise, grease, and heavy machinery
